Delicious Oatmeal Raisin Cookies
For those who love a chewy texture with a hint of spice, oatmeal raisin cookies are a fantastic choice. They offer a wholesome flavor with the perfect balance between sweet and savory.
- Ingredients:
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up brown sugar, packed
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 3 cups old-fashioned oats
- 1 cup raisins
- Instructions:
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, cream together the but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until smooth.
-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ition, then stir in the vanilla.
- Combine the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t in a separate bowl.
-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ture.
- Stir in the oats and raisins until evenly distributed.
-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ake for 10 to 12 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own.
- Allow cookies to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before moving them to wire racks.
Festive Sugar Cookies
These sugar cookies are perfect for any celebration—from birthdays to holidays. Their sweet flavor and soft texture make them a crowd-pleaser, especially when decorated!
- Ingredients:
- 2 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 1/2 cups white sugar
- 1 egg
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 teaspoon almond extract
- 3 to 4 tablespoons sugar for decoration
- Instructions:
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a small bowl, stir together the flour, baking soda, and baking powder; set aside.
- In a large bowl, cream the butter and sugar until smooth.
- Beat in the egg, vanilla extract, and almond extract.
- Gradually blend in the dry ingredients.
- Roll rounded teaspoonfuls of dough into balls, then roll in sugar.
- Place onto ungreased baking sheets, spaced about 1 inch apart.
- Bake 8 to 10 minutes in the preheated oven, or until golden.
- Let cool on wire racks before decorating as desired.
Peanut Butter Cookies
Peanut butter cookies are a classic indulgence that offers a delightful nutty flavor and a satisfying crunch. These cookies are easy to make and perfect for any peanut butter lover.
- Ingredients:
- 1 cup peanut butter
- 1 cup white sugar
- 1 egg
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a medium bowl, mix together the peanut butter, sugar, egg, and baking soda until well blended.
-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Press down with a fork to create a crisscross pattern on top of each cookie.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 8 to 10 minutes, or until edges are lightly browned.
- Allow to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ack.
Snickerdoodle Cookies
Snickerdoodles are known for their soft, chewy texture and the delightful taste of cinnamon and sugar. These cookies are simple yet incredibly satisfying.
- Ingredients:
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 2 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 teaspoons cream of tartar
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 3 tablespoons sugar
- 3 teaspoons ground cinnamon
-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, cream together the butter, 1 1/2 cups sugar, and eggs until smooth.
- In another bowl, combine the flour, cream of tartar, baking soda, and salt; gradually add to the creamed mixture.
- In a small bowl, mix the remaining sugar and cinnamon.
- Roll dough into balls and then roll in the cinnamon sugar mixture.
- Place on ungreased baking sheets and bake for 8 to 10 minutes.
- Let cool for a few minutes before transferring to wire racks.
Funfetti Cookies
Add a splash of color to your baking with funfetti cookies! These cookies are perfect for celebrations, featuring sprinkles that bring joy to every bite.
- Ingredients:
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up packed brown s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- 2 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up rainbow sprinkles
-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, cream together the but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until smooth.
- Add the eggs and vanilla, mixing well.
- In a separate bowl, combine the flour, baking soda, and salt. Gradually mix this into the wet ingredients.
- Fold in the rainbow sprinkles gently.
-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ake for 10 to 12 minutes, or until the edges are slightly golden.
- C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to wire racks.
Double Chocolate Cookies
For the chocolate enthusiasts, double chocolate cookies are a dream come true. Rich and fudgy, these cookies pack a chocolate punch that will satisfy any sweet tooth.
- Ingredients:
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up chocolate chips
-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, cream together the butter and sugar until fluffy.
- Beat in the e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la.
- Combine the fl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, and salt in a separate bowl.
-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ture.
- Fold in the chocolate chips until evenly distributed.
- Drop by rounded tablespoons on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ake for 10 to 12 minutes, or until set.
- Let cool for a few minutes before transferring to wire racks.

Peanut Butter Blossoms
These classic peanut butter cookies topped with a chocolate kiss are not only adorable but also incredibly delicious. Perfect for parties or just a sweet treat at home!
- Ingredients:
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 egg
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1 bag of chocolate kisses, unwrapped
-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a bowl, mix together the peanut butter, sugar, egg, baking soda, and salt until smooth.
- Roll the mixture into 1-inch balls and place them on 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ake for 8 to 10 minutes, until the edges are just set.
- Remove from the oven and immediately press a chocolate kiss into the center of each cookie.
- Allow to c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to wire racks.
